Going to purchase a bolt on precision 50 trim here locally. One question I have is, by bolt on does that mean the oil feed and all other lines to and from the turbo are the same as 14b/16g?

Also what is a decent price for a used one with no shaft play? Can't seem to find a new one to compare pricing
 
It will bolt on assuming its flanged for a mitsu manifold and o2 housing but should use garret (or some other type not mitsu) style oil feed and drain lines.

Oh I also believe they don't use coolant lines so you need to block / loop the coolant lines.
